Power Window SUBSWITCH Inspection: Notes
W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2016 Mazda MX-5 Miata.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
- Disconnect the negative battery cable. (See NEGATIVE BATTERY CABLE DISCONNECTION/CONNECTION .)
- Remove the power window subswitch. (See POWER WINDOW SUBSWITCH REMOVAL/INSTALLATION .)
- Connect the power window subswitch connector.
- Connect the negative battery cable. (See NEGATIVE BATTERY CABLE DISCONNECTION/CONNECTION .)
- Verify that the voltages of each of the terminals are as indicated in the terminal voltage table (reference).
- If the voltage is not as specified in the terminal voltage table (reference), inspect the parts under Inspection item(s) and related wiring harnesses.
- If the system does not work normally even though the inspection items are normal, replace the power window subswitch.
